An Introduction to Computer Science & Programming | LECT 3.3: Compilers, Compilation, & Types of Errors | in Arabic

Lecture 3: Computational Thinking – Part 3
Section 3.3: Compilers, Compilation, & Types of Errors
- Preprocessor
- Compiler
- Assembler
- Linker
- Types of Errors
- Critical & Real-time Systems

Lecture Notes (Lecture Slides in PDF) + Exercises (Problem Sheets) + Lecture Codes (Source Codes for Examples in Lecture Notes) are all available at the following link: https://drive.google.com/drive/folders/1RTakuNor6594Z289NWygz1lmd-jjHHQ-

Additional Resources:
1) Introduction to Real-Time Software Systems: https://www.youtube.com/watch?v=_U6Le3_eL2I
2) Short Lesson - Compilation vs Interpretation: https://www.youtube.com/watch?v=JNMy969SjyU
3) Compiling, assembling, and linking: https://www.youtube.com/watch?v=N2y6csonII4
4) COMPILER| INTERPRETER |Difference between Interpreter and Compiler| Interpreter vs Compiler Animated: https://www.youtube.com/watch?v=e4ax90XmUBc

Subscribe and hit the bell to see new videos: https://www.youtube.com/AmrSGhoneim?sub_confirmation=1

#ComputerScience #Programming #C #C++ #Coding #Technology #Programmer #Developer #Arabic